FREE tools

Die Magie von Power Query: Bedingte Logik mit IF-Anweisungen

Lukas Fuchs vor 11 Monaten Performance & SEO 3 Min. Lesezeit

Entdecken Sie die vielfältigen Möglichkeiten von Power Query, insbesondere wie Sie mit IF-Anweisungen Ihre Daten transformieren und analysieren können. Dieser Artikel zeigt Ihnen, wie Sie die IF-Funktion effektiv einsetzen können, um Ihre Excel- und Power BI-Projekte zu optimieren.

Was ist Power Query?

Power Query ist ein leistungsstarkes Tool zur Datenmanipulation und -vorbereitung, das in Excel und Power BI integriert ist. Es ermöglicht Benutzern, Daten aus verschiedenen Quellen zu importieren, zu transformieren und zu kombinieren, ohne tiefgehende Programmierkenntnisse zu benötigen. Mit Power Query können Sie Ihre Daten in ein ansprechendes Format bringen, bevor Sie Analysen oder Berichte erstellen.

Warum IF-Anweisungen in Power Query?

Die IF-Anweisung ist ein zentrales Element der bedingten Logik in Power Query. Sie ermöglicht es Ihnen, Entscheidungen innerhalb Ihrer Datenabfragen zu treffen. Mit dieser Funktion können Sie spezifische Bedingungen definieren und darauf basierende Werte oder Aktionen festlegen.

Die Grundlagen der IF-Anweisung in Power Query

Die Syntax der IF-Anweisung in Power Query sieht folgendermaßen aus:

if Bedinung then Wert_Wenn_Wahr else Wert_Wenn_Falsch
Hier sind die Hauptbestandteile:

  • Bedinung: Der Ausdruck, der überprüft wird.
  • Wert_Wenn_Wahr: Der Wert, der ausgegeben wird, wenn die Bedingung wahr ist.
  • Wert_Wenn_Falsch: Der Wert, der ausgegeben wird, wenn die Bedingung falsch ist.

Beispiel: Verwendung von IF in Power Query

Stellen Sie sich vor, Sie haben eine Tabelle mit Verkaufsdaten, in der die Spalte "Umsatz" die Werte enthält. Sie möchten in einer neuen Spalte angeben, ob der Umsatz „hoch“, „mittel“ oder „niedrig“ ist. Sie könnten dieses Beispiel wie folgt umsetzen:

if [Umsatz] > 10000 then "hoch" 
else if [Umsatz] > 5000 then "mittel" 
else "niedrig"

In diesem Beispiel wird die IF-Anweisung verwendet, um die Verkaufskategorie basierend auf dem Umsatz zu bestimmen. Dies macht es einfach, die Ergebnisse visuell zu analysieren.

Verschachtelung von IF-Anweisungen

Manchmal benötigen Sie mehrere Bedingungen, die aufeinander aufbauen. In solchen Fällen können IF-Anweisungen verschachtelt werden. Hier ein Beispiel:

if [Umsatz] > 10000 then "hoch"  
else if [Umsatz] > 5000 then "mittel"  
else if [Umsatz] > 1000 then "niedrig"  
else "kein Umsatz"

Diese verschachtelte Struktur ermöglicht komplexere Entscheidungsszenarien und hilft Ihnen, tiefere Einblicke in Ihre Daten zu gewinnen.

Fehlerbehandlung mit IF

Die IF-Anweisung kann auch zur Fehlerbehandlung genutzt werden. Angenommen, Sie arbeiten mit einer Spalte, die NULL-Werte enthalten kann, und möchten nur die gültigen Werte analysieren. Sie könnten die IF-Anweisung wie folgt anpassen:

if [Umsatz] = null then 0  
else if [Umsatz] > 10000 then "hoch"  
else "niedrig"

Hier wird der NULL-Wert überprüft und durch 0 ersetzt, was die Analyse einfacher und robuster macht.

Tipps zur effektiven Anwendung von IF in Power Query

  • Planen Sie Ihre Bedingungen: Überlegen Sie sich im Voraus, welche Bedingungen Sie verwenden möchten, um Redundanzen zu vermeiden.
  • Verwenden Sie Kommentare: Kommentieren Sie Ihre IF-Anweisungen, um den Code leichter verständlich zu machen, insbesondere wenn Sie komplexe Bedingungen verwenden.
  • Testen Sie Schritt für Schritt: Fügen Sie neue IF-Bedingungen schrittweise hinzu und testen Sie Ihre Abfragen gründlich, um sicherzustellen, dass alles wie erwartet funktioniert.

Fazit

Die Verwendung von IF-Anweisungen in Power Query eröffnet Ihnen die Möglichkeit, Ihre Datentransformationen wesentlich flexibler und intelligenter zu gestalten. Sie können nicht nur einfache Bedingungen prüfen, sondern auch komplexere Logik anwenden, um Ihre Daten optimal zu bearbeiten. Durch das Vergleichen, Verschachteln und Behandeln von Fehlern verwandelt sich Ihre Datenabfrage in ein kraftvolles Werkzeug, das Ihnen tiefere Einblicke in Ihre Analysen bietet.

Nutzen Sie die Möglichkeiten von Power Query und integrieren Sie die IF-Anweisung in Ihre Datenvorbereitung, um Ihre Projekte effizienter und effektiver zu gestalten. Wenn Sie weitere Tipps und Tricks zu Power Query erfahren möchten, besuchen Sie regelmäßig unseren Blog!

Weitere Beiträge

Folge uns

Neue Beiträge

APIs & Microservices

ISE Return Infinite: Alles, was du wissen musst über den neuen Retourenservice von DHL

AUTOR • Jun 18, 2026
Webdesign & UX

Symboltoixacmlluo Arbeit: Die unerzählte Bedeutung hinter dem Code einfach erklärt

AUTOR • Jun 18, 2026
Frontend-Entwicklung

PDF nicht im Browser öffnen: So änderst du die Einstellung dauerhaft

AUTOR • Jun 18, 2026
Webdesign & UX

taskkill pid: Prozesse per PID in Windows gezielt beenden

AUTOR • Jun 18, 2026
DevOps & Deployment

PSWindowsUpdate nutzen: Windows-Updates per PowerShell schnell, sauber und automatisiert steuern

AUTOR • Jun 18, 2026
Webdesign & UX

Windows-Suche aktivieren: So machst du die Windows-Suche schnell wieder nutzbar

AUTOR • Jun 18, 2026
Webdesign & UX

Zellschutz in Excel aufheben: So entfernst du den Blattschutz schnell und sauber

AUTOR • Jun 18, 2026
Webdesign & UX

Excel Diagramm Formel anzeigen: So machst du Formeln im Diagramm sichtbar und verständlich

AUTOR • Jun 18, 2026
DevOps & Deployment

FQDN Linux: Was der Fully Qualified Domain Name in Linux wirklich bringt

AUTOR • Jun 18, 2026
Webdesign & UX

Inbus Loch: Was es ist, wie du es misst und wann du es brauchst

AUTOR • Jun 18, 2026
Webdesign & UX

How to Create a Table of Contents for Your Blog: Mehr Klicks, bessere Lesbarkeit, mehr SEO

AUTOR • Jun 18, 2026
Webdesign & UX

E-Mail Adresse Verfügbarkeit prüfen: So findest du schnell freie Namen für dein Projekt

AUTOR • Jun 18, 2026
Backend-Entwicklung

cat Linux Befehl: Dateiinhalt schnell anzeigen, kombinieren und prüfen

AUTOR • Jun 18, 2026
Webdesign & UX

Smileys in Word Einfügen: So geht's einfach und schnell!

AUTOR • Jun 18, 2026
APIs & Microservices

Web3 Universe Erfahrung: Was ich dort wirklich gelernt habe

AUTOR • Jun 18, 2026
Webdesign & UX

Word Verlinkung auf Kapitel: So setzt du klickbare Sprungmarken im Dokument

AUTOR • Jun 18, 2026
Frontend-Entwicklung

ExifTool Anleitung: Bilder und Metadaten in Minuten prüfen, ändern und löschen

AUTOR • Jun 18, 2026
Datenbanken & ORM

Partition mit TestDisk wiederherstellen: So rettest du verlorene Partitionen schnell und sauber

AUTOR • Jun 18, 2026
APIs & Microservices

Middleware Beispiel: So funktioniert Middleware in der Praxis

AUTOR • Jun 18, 2026
Webdesign & UX

Bild in E-Mail einfügen Outlook: So klappt es schnell und sauber

AUTOR • Jun 18, 2026

Beliebte Beiträge

DevOps & Deployment

Powershell Zertifikate: Alles, was Sie wissen müssen

AUTOR • Jul 16, 2025
DevOps & Deployment

Anleitung: So änderst du die IP-Adresse unter Ubuntu in wenigen Schritten

AUTOR • Jul 16, 2025
Performance & SEO

Gmail Synchronisierungsfehler: Ursachen und Lösungen

AUTOR • Jul 02, 2025
Performance & SEO

Das perfekte Datum-Format in Excel: Tipps und Tricks für jedes Projekt

AUTOR • Jul 01, 2025
Performance & SEO

DNS PTR: Was sind sie und warum sind sie wichtig für dein Netzwerk?

AUTOR • Jul 01, 2025
Performance & SEO

Schritt-für-Schritt-Anleitung: Ordnerücken in Word erstellen

AUTOR • Jun 26, 2025
Webdesign & UX

Samsung TV AirPlay aktivieren: So einfach geht's!

AUTOR • Jun 25, 2025
Webdesign & UX

Anleitung zum Ändern des Layouts in PowerPoint: Tipps und Tricks für perfekte Präsentationen

AUTOR • Jun 20, 2025
Webdesign & UX

So Entfernen Sie Überflüssige Windows Update Dateien für Mehr Speicherplatz

AUTOR • Jun 17, 2025
Webdesign & UX

Container in HTML: Die Grundlage für ein responsives Webdesign

AUTOR • Jun 17, 2025
Webdesign & UX

Die besten Alternativen zu Adobe Acrobat: Kostenlose und kostenpflichtige Optionen im Vergleich

AUTOR • Jun 09, 2025
DevOps & Deployment

IPConfig im Mac Terminal: Der ultimative Leitfaden für Netzwerkeinstellungen

AUTOR • Jun 08, 2025
DevOps & Deployment

Fixing the "ERR_CONNECTION_CLOSED" Error in WordPress

AUTOR • Sep 30, 2023
Backend-Entwicklung

Wordpress Anit-Maleware Plugins

AUTOR • Oct 01, 2022
Webdesign & UX

Einfach und schnell: Erstelle Visitenkarten online

AUTOR • Sep 22, 2024
Performance & SEO

Die Bedeutung der Abkürzung 'cy': Was steckt dahinter?

AUTOR • Jul 09, 2025
Webdesign & UX

Die ultimative Anleitung zur Excel Suche nach Wert in einer Spalte

AUTOR • Jul 01, 2025
Webdesign & UX

Effizientes Seriendrucken mit Word und Excel: Eine Schritt-für-Schritt-Anleitung

AUTOR • Jul 01, 2025
Backend-Entwicklung

Wie man richtig testet: Der umfassende Leitfaden für effektives Testen

AUTOR • Jun 27, 2025
Frontend-Entwicklung

Schnell und einfach: Dateien auf OneDrive hochladen

AUTOR • Jun 26, 2025